Game Introduction

Precision Rooftop Arena is an engaging action game where players compete on rooftops overlooking a lively city. The goal is simple: outsmart your opponents with careful aim and strategic moves. You move across your rooftop, using your scope to spot opponents on nearby buildings. When you find them, take aim and fire your blaster. But be careful—they are shooting at you too! If you see blasts coming from a direction, that is where your opponent is hiding. Use rooftop fixtures like ventilation units and dumpsters as shields to stay safe. The game offers five difficulty levels: Easy, Medium, Hard, Veteran, and Legend. Each level has a set number of targets to overcome. Win a level by overcoming all targets to advance. Complete all five levels to become the ultimate precision master. It is a test of accuracy, patience, and strategy.

How to Play

To play Precision Rooftop Arena, start by selecting a difficulty level. Use your mouse or touch controls to move your character across the rooftop. Look through the scope to scan neighboring rooftops for opponents. When you spot a target, aim carefully and click to shoot. Watch out for enemy fire—if you get hit, you lose. Use barriers like ventilation units to hide and avoid shots. The opponents will also hide behind objects like dumpsters, so you need to be patient and wait for a clear shot. Each level requires you to overcome a specific number of targets. Win by overcoming all opponents in that level to advance to the next. The game is simple to learn but challenging to master, especially on harder difficulties.
